Anyone who is no longer satisfied with the premium or service has to change the basic insurance. Health insurance companies have to cover everyone with compulsory health insurance.
Tip 1 – Termination
The termination must reach the old health insurance within working hours by 30 November at the latest. At the same time, the record must be available to the new insurer by that time. The Federal Office of Public Health (FOPH) recommends sending a letter by registered mail or A Mail Plus, if possible, by mid-November for both termination and registration.
If you only want to change the exemption rate with the current insurer, you must do so by the end of November for a lower exemption and you have until the end of the year for a higher exemption.
Tip #2 – Compare bonuses
Watch out for some health insurance brokers, take a close look at their premium comparisons! Be careful when making an appointment with a health insurance agent. Many insured individuals are not suited to the pressure and negotiation skills of brokers. If there is an appointment, do not sign anything at the first meeting – neither a notice of termination, nor a power of attorney, nor an application.
- Compare right! Premium calculators are available on various portals such as Compparis.ch (choose the full view of offers), Swupp.ch or Moneyland.ch.
Tip 3 – Premium calculator from the federal government
Insurance quotes from all health insurers can be found on FOPH’s Priminfo.ch platform. In addition, BAG has set up the telephone line 058 464 88 01. The insured can contact this phone immediately for their questions.
And think carefully about the medical costs and treatments you will face in the coming year. After that, the franchise needs to be adjusted: experts recommend either the highest or the lowest. An occasional franchise isn’t worth it.
